Although I have shown one form of mechanism embodying my invention, it is ob vious that various changes within the skill of the mechanic may be made in said mechanism without departing from the spirit of the invention provided the means set forth in the following claims be employed.
I claim as my invention:-
1. A horn comprising a me al'diaphragm having annular corrugations therein, an actuating member secured to said diaphragm, a movable disk having radial ribs or flanges thereon adapted to engage with said actuating member and vibrate the diaphragm, and means to actuate said disk.
2. Ahorn comprising a diaphragm under tension, an actuating member secured to said diaphragm comprising a plug and a passage therein with a restricted opening at one end to form a ball seat, a ball in said passage and means for securing said ball in said passage to cause a segment thereof to project beyond the end of the plug, a disk provided with means engaging said proje ing segmentof said ball to produce to azxl fro movement ofthediaphragm and means for moving said disk.
3. A horn com ')rising a metal diaphragm under tension having annular grooves there in, an actuating member secured to said diaphragm and comprising a ball rotatable in said member and held against displacement with respect thereto, a disk having radial ribs'on its surface to engage with sa' ,1 actuating member, a driving gear for rotating said disk, a driving pinion, means for aetuating said driving pinion, and a clutch mechanism between said fpinion and driving gear substantially as described.
1t. In a device of the class described, .meehanism for actuating a diaphragm horn comprising a diaphragm actuating mem ber formed of a disk provided with diametrically disposed diaphragm contacting ribs and provided with open spaces between adjacent ribs, a shaft supporting said disk centrally thereof, a pinion fixed to said shaft and constituting the end member of a train of gears, a second member of said train meshing with said pinion, a manually actuated reciprocating member and means between said reciprocating member and said second gear train member for converting the reciprocating movement of said handle into continuous rotary movement of said disk, said mechanism being freely rotatable.
5. In a mechanism for actuating a diaphragm horn, a diaphragm engaging member comprising a shaft, a disk mounted on said shaft one flat surface of said disk being provided with radial grooves to form ribs beveled in'sectionand of varying width. said ribs being spaced apart and adapted to engage a projection from the diaphragm of the horn to vibrate said diznhragm and means for rotating said disk a out an axis perpendicular to said grooved face.
